- Remote Licensed Mental Health Counselor – Geriatric Specialization
Description
Position Overview
Willow Counseling Center is seeking a dedicated Licensed Mental Health Counselor to join our team on a full-time basis. This remote role is perfect for a licensed professional who is passionate about providing mental health support to elderly patients. You will be integral in delivering high-quality mental health services, focusing on geriatric psychiatry and helping improve the lives of older adults.
About the Organization
At Willow Counseling Center, we specialize in mental health treatment for seniors, addressing a breadth of challenges including depression, anxiety, dementia-related disorders, and adjustment issues. Our team comprises experienced geriatric psychiatrists and a diverse group of mental health professionals dedicated to enhancing the mental well-being of our elderly clientele. Located in Scottsdale, Arizona, we provide our services through a comprehensive telehealth platform, making our support accessible to patients from the comfort of their homes.

Key Responsibilities
- Conduct thorough mental health assessments tailored to the unique needs of older adults, ensuring that each patient's physical, emotional, and social contexts are considered.
- Design and execute personalized treatment plans that address cognitive changes and various geriatric psychiatric conditions, utilizing evidence-based practice models.
- Deliver individual and family therapy sessions aimed at alleviating the distress caused by psychiatric disorders prevalent within the geriatric population.
- Collaborate closely with our team of geriatric psychiatrists and healthcare professionals to provide integrated care, ensuring that all aspects of a patient's well-being are addressed.
- Provide crisis intervention during mental health emergencies, offering immediate support and appropriate referrals when necessary.
- Educate patients and their families about treatment options and connect them with community resources to further support their mental health journey.
- Maintain meticulous and confidential documentation that meets all legal and ethical standards, utilizing our electronic health record (EHR) system for streamlined operational efficiency.
- Actively engage in team meetings and case consultations to enhance therapeutic strategies and outcomes.
- Stay updated with the latest research and best practices in geriatric psychiatry to continually refine your clinical skills and knowledge.

Qualifications
- A Master's or Doctoral degree in Social Work, Marriage and Family Therapy, Mental Health Counseling, or Psychology from an accredited institution.
- Current and valid licensure in the state of Arizona as an LCSW, LPC, or LMFT.
- Strong understanding of geriatric mental health disorders and the ability to implement effective evidence-based treatments.
- Exceptional interpersonal skills and a demonstrated patient-centered approach in all interactions.
- Proficiency in using electronic health records to manage patient information efficiently and maintain accurate documentation.
Preferred Experience
- A minimum of two years of post-licensure experience working with older adults, particularly in a mental health capacity.
- Experience in delivering family therapy specifically within the geriatric context.
- Familiarity with telehealth platforms and remote therapy methodologies.
